Common decisions people bring

→ Build vs. buy (should we build this internally or use a vendor?)
→ Ship vs. wait (is this ready or are we rushing?)
→ Kill vs. keep (this feature isn't performing — do we sunset it?)
→ Prioritization deadlock (two big bets, resources for one — which one?)
→ Team structure (do we hire, reorganize, or outsource?)
→ Pricing & packaging (how do we price this new product?)
→ Partnership decisions (do we integrate, compete, or ignore?)
